Where Were Hurricanes Built In Canada?

Fort William, Ontario. A major manufacturer of the Hurricane was Canadian Car and Foundry at their factory in Fort William, Ontario, Canada, receiving their initial contract for 40 Hurricanes in November 1938. What Is Emergency In Canada?

A national emergency is an urgent, temporary and critical situation that seriously endangers the health and safety of Canadians or that seriously threatens the ability of the Government of Canada to preserve the sovereignty, security and territorial integrity of Canada. What Was The Biggest Natural Disaster In Canada?

The 1997 Red River flood in Manitoba and the 2013 flood in southern and central Alberta wrought the worst damage in the country’s history.
